“There’s a big range of style between frosted and not-frosted vines, the bottoms and tops of our vineyards, and the first and second generation grapes,” said Marc Bachelet, adding that gentle pressing helped him “avoid getting a strong influence from the small, less-ripe berries." Alcohol levels are a touch lower in 2016 than in 2017, but acidity levels and pHs are similar in the two vintages, he added.
